Samsung India likely to launch Galaxy S3 in May, Galaxy Note successor in Q3

Samsung is all set to become India’s biggest cellphone vendor by value by March this year even as it is working on adding new high-end smartphones to its already large portfolio. We have learned Samsung is still on track to launch the Galaxy Nexus in March, followed by the Galaxy S3 in May in India. According to people familiar with the matter, India was always in the second or third wave of Galaxy Nexus launch countries, though we have received mixed signals when we were told that the launch had been ‘rescheduled’ for January.
The Galaxy S2, which still remains to be Samsung’s largest selling Android smartphone in the high-end segment, will receive a price-cut sometime in between the two product launches. Though not very surprising, we are also hearing Samsung has done good numbers of the Galaxy Note without cannibalizing sales of either the S2 or its similar priced Tabs, highly placed sources within the company tell us. The Note is also scheduled to get an update later in Q3 of this year. Of course, Samsung will continue adding more phones to its entry and mid-level Android portfolio through the year.
